Recruitment Process Outsourcing (RPO) has become a pivotal solution for many businesses seeking to optimize their hiring strategies. At the heart of this transformation is the concept of an RPO squad. But what exactly comprises an RPO squad, and how does it differentiate from typical recruitment practices?

An RPO squad is essentially a dedicated team of professional recruiters and resources provided by RPO providers. They are tasked with streamlining the recruitment process for a company, managing tasks from talent acquisition to the final hiring decision. An RPO squad typically comprises the following key components:

  • RPO Teams: These are specialized teams that work in tandem with a company’s internal team to enhance their recruitment capabilities. By leveraging their expertise, RPO teams help fill roles efficiently, reducing the time to hire while maintaining high talent standards.
  • Pre-vetted Talent Pools: RPO providers often have access to expansive, pre-vetted talent pools, ensuring a diverse selection of top candidates ready for the hiring process. This build optimizes the candidate experience by minimizing delays and improving the match between candidates and roles.
  • Process Outsourcing: By outsourcing the recruitment process, businesses can bypass operational bottlenecks and focus on core competencies. RPO squads take over complex recruitment tasks, allowing teams to devote their energy to strategic objectives.

The role of an RPO squad is dynamic and multifaceted. They are not just an extension of the HR department; they are a strategic partner that aligns business goals with talent needs. This alignment is crucial for businesses looking to gain a competitive edge in the hiring game. Challenges Faced by RPO Squads

Overcoming Challenges in RPO Team Operations

The world of Recruitment Process Outsourcing (RPO) offers numerous advantages in enhancing talent acquisition for organizations. However, as beneficial as RPO squads are, they aren't without their hurdles. Addressing these challenges effectively requires an understanding of both the RPO dynamics and the overall recruitment landscape. One of the primary challenges RPO providers face is ensuring a seamless integration with a company's internal team and processes. Every business has its unique culture and practices, which can sometimes make alignment tricky for RPO squads. However, by fostering open communication and a shared understanding of goals, this integration can be significantly improved. A successful partnership demands that the RPO squad not just understand the company's immediate hiring needs, but also its long-term talent strategy. Timing is another crucial factor. Ensuring a prompt time to hire can be a challenge, particularly during top hiring seasons. RPO teams are often tasked with the responsibility of sourcing pre-vetted candidates from diverse talent pools quickly. The urgency to fill positions must be balanced with maintaining a high-quality candidate experience—a task that requires both strategic planning and efficient execution. Privacy and data management also play pivotal roles in overcoming challenges. Strict adherence to privacy policies and user agreements is vital to both candidate and company trust. RPO squads must ensure that all recruitment processes are compliant with relevant regulations to safeguard sensitive information. Lastly, maintaining transparency and cultivating trust in the recruitment process remains an ongoing challenge. Companies often hesitate to relinquish control to external RPO partners due to concerns about losing direct oversight. However, a clear outline of responsibilities, outcomes, and regular communication can help minimize these worries, encouraging a more productive and trusting cooperation. Ultimately, successful RPO teams are those that anticipate these challenges and respond with adaptable strategies that align with the company's hiring objectives and values. This proactive approach can turn what seem like hurdles into opportunities for improved recruitment outcomes and stronger partnerships.
